Resource Allocation Strategies for MCP Server Environments
Optimizing resource allocation within a multi-core processing (MCP) server environment is crucial for maximizing overall system throughput. This involves carefully distributing CPU time, memory allocation, and network bandwidth across multiple virtual machines or applications running on the shared hardware. Effective strategies often involve adopting dynamic load balancing algorithms to assign resources based on real-time workload demands. Furthermore, implementing resource quotas can prevent resource exhaustion by individual workloads, ensuring fair and equitable distribution across the entire system.
- Evaluate implementing a containerization platform like Docker to enhance resource isolation and simplify workload management.
- Track system metrics such as CPU utilization, memory consumption, and network traffic to identify potential bottlenecks and adjust resource allocation accordingly.
- Employ automated tools and scripts for dynamic resource provisioning and scaling based on predefined thresholds or workload patterns.
